Output eb27c887d7b8a8b75cfc190128a0c67174c76bf12feecabb387ec7353d90e25c:1

value
529139
script pubkey
OP_0 OP_PUSHBYTES_20 38529cbab04d9766ca1aa2ce36cb2af766a9fc6a
address
bc1q8pffew4sfktkdjs65t8rdje27an2nlr2asya0t
transaction
eb27c887d7b8a8b75cfc190128a0c67174c76bf12feecabb387ec7353d90e25c
confirmations
47563
spent
true